How can I prove that the school board was negligent in my accident?
In Arizona, when it comes to proving the school board was negligent in a school bus accident, the injured party is required to demonstrate that the school board did not take reasonable and necessary precautions to protect students or other people from harm. Generally, this involves establishing that the school board: (1) knew, or should have known, that the unsafe condition posed a risk; (2) failed to take steps to address the unsafe condition, or took steps that were inadequate to make the condition safe; and (3) the non-compliance with safety practices caused the injury. Evidence to support a negligence claim against the school board in an Arizona school bus accident can include witness statements, photographs of the scene, accident reports, medical records, and any other type of evidence that supports a claim of negligence. Expert testimony may also be used to support a negligence claim, especially when the violation involves a specific safety procedure or regulation. In order to establish negligence on behalf of the school board, an injured party must prove that the school board failed to exercise the necessary level of care that a reasonable person would exercise to ensure the safety of students or others. It must be shown that the school board had a legal duty to act in a certain way, but failed to do so, causing the injury.
